Undergraduate Tuition & Fees

For the academic year 2023-2024, the undergraduate tuition & fees at Blue Ridge Community and Technical College is $4,344 for West Virginia residents and $7,848 for out-of-state students. It has been risen by 5.23% for West Virginia residents and increased by 5.14% for out-of-state rates compared to the previous year. Its in-state undergraduate tuition and fees is a little bit lower than the average amount ($4,914) and its out-of-state undergraduate tuition and fees is a little bit lower than the average amount for similar schools' tuition of $9,174.
The 2025 estimated undergraduate tuition & fees for Blue Ridge Community and Technical is $4,571 for West Virginia residents and $8,252 for out-of-state students which is a 5.1% increase compared to 2024's rate.

The living costs including for room, board, transpiration, and other personal expenses is $10,255 when a student live off campus for year 2024. The off-campus living costs increased by 7.31% compared to the previous year.

Tuition Per Credit Hour

The below table describes the cost per credit hour for part-time students and/or full-time students who take additional courses more than regular credit hours at Blue Ridge Community and Technical. The undergraduate tuition per credit hour is $181 for West Virginia residents and $327 for out-of-state students.
